Blackhawks tab Jeff Blashill as head coach
The Chicago Blackhawks hired Tampa Bay Lightning assistant Jeff Blashill as their new head coach on Thursday.,Blashill replaces Anders Sorensen, who was Chicago's interim coach after the December firing of Luke Richardson.,Blashill, 51, will begin his second stint as a head coach in the NHL.
